How Much Does a Carpenter Cost in Montrose?

Typical carpenter costs in Montrose, Scotland range from £40–£65 per hour. Get realistic local pricing for joinery and carpentry work.

Carpenter costs in Montrose vary depending on the complexity of the project, materials used, and whether the work is bespoke or standard joinery. Most local carpenters charge between £40 and £65 per hour, with many offering fixed quotes for larger jobs such as kitchen installations or loft conversions. Montrose's location in Angus means prices are typically at or slightly below the Scottish average. Carpenter Prices in Montrose

Service Typical Cost Unit
Fitted kitchen installation (supply not included) £800 – £1400 per job
Bespoke wardrobes and fitted furniture £600 – £1200 per item
Door hanging and frame installation £60 – £120 per door
Skirting boards and architrave fitting £12 – £20 per linear metre
Shelving installation (floating or bracket-mounted) £80 – £150 per set
Loft boarding and storage solutions £400 – £900 per job
Decking installation £25 – £45 per square metre
General carpentry labour £40 – £65 per hour

Prices are indicative averages for Montrose. Actual quotes will vary based on job specifics.

What Affects the Cost?

Several factors influence carpenter pricing in Montrose. Job complexity—whether it's basic shelving or bespoke fitted furniture—significantly affects costs. Material selection, from budget-friendly MDF to premium hardwoods, impacts the total price. The scope and duration of the project, site accessibility, and whether structural work is involved all play a role. Seasonal demand and the carpenter's experience level can also influence quotes. Local material availability in Montrose is generally good, keeping supply-related costs reasonable.

Money-Saving Tips

To reduce costs, plan your project clearly before getting quotes, as design changes mid-work increase labour time and expenses. Consider standard sizes and finishes rather than fully bespoke options—they're often significantly cheaper. Sourcing your own materials from local suppliers in Montrose can save money, though labour quotes remain separate. Bundling multiple jobs with one carpenter may also secure better rates.

Frequently Asked Questions

What's the typical cost for a fitted kitchen in Montrose?
A basic fitted kitchen installation (labour only, materials supplied by you) typically costs £800–£1,400, depending on the number of units, complexity of layout, and whether wall modifications are needed. Bespoke kitchens with custom cabinetry cost significantly more. Always request a detailed quote after the carpenter inspects your space.
Do carpenters in Montrose charge by the hour or by fixed quote?
Most experienced carpenters offer both. For straightforward jobs like door hanging or shelving, hourly rates (£40–£65/hour) are common. Larger projects like kitchens or loft conversions are usually quoted as fixed-price jobs to manage your budget and ensure timely completion.
How long does a typical fitted wardrobe installation take?
A single fitted wardrobe typically takes 1–3 days, depending on size and complexity. This translates to £600–£1,200 in labour costs. Installation time is affected by wall condition, whether shelving and rods are bespoke, and if structural adjustments are required.
Are there any seasonal price variations for carpenters in Montrose?
Yes, demand tends to be higher in spring and summer, and some carpenters may have longer lead times or charge slightly higher rates during peak months. Booking in autumn or winter often results in faster service and potentially better availability for negotiating prices.
